Abstract
Angular distributions of the polarization transfer coefficients , , and (Wolfenstein parameters , , and were measured at 16.2 MeV for elastic scattering. The angular range covered was 30° to 90° (lab) in 10° steps. The experiment used a polarized proton beam of 150 to 200 nA, a liquid-nitrogen cooled gas target, and a -filled proton polarimeter. The transfer coefficients are well described by an -matrix analysis of the system.
